Richard F.
Johnson
is the founder of Lakeside Occupational Medical Centers, Inc., which was founded in 1978.
He held the title of President & Medical Director at the company.
Dr. Johnson's current jobs include being a Director at the University of South Florida, a Member of the National Safety Council, a Member of the National Utility Contractors Association, the President-Private Practice Division at the American College of Occupational & Environmental Medicine since 2011, a Member of the Bay Area Manufacturers Association, and a Member of the Suncoast Utility Contractors Association.
Dr. Johnson's former job includes being the President of the NASW Florida Chapter.
